1 Asphaltenes are defined as the fraction of the bitumen that is soluble in toluene and insoluble in n-alkane solvents. Because they are defined by solubility, there is no single molecule, chemical composition or structure that defines an "asphaltene". More …

Asphaltenes in Bitumen, What They Are and What They Are Not

Sep 20, 2011· Asphaltenes in bitumen and crude oil are generally defined as the fraction which is insoluble in n-heptane. There is also a perceived definition which describes asphaltenes as a very polar, high molecular weight fraction in bitumen. The standard definition and the perceived definition are not identical and thus a lot of confusion has been created.

Direct observation of the asphaltene structure in paving ...

Bitumen is the residue from the vacuum distillation of petroleum oil. The bitumen's partial solubility in a non-polar solvent can be used to separate it into two broad fractions: asphaltenes and maltenes. The asphaltenes are defined as the bitumen fraction that is insoluble in n-heptane. Asphaltenes are polar

The Paradox of Asphaltene Precipitation with Normal ...

Apr 21, 2005· For bitumens and crude oils, the volume of n-paraffin at the flocculation point, which is the point of incipient asphaltene precipitation, increases as the n-paraffin carbon number increases, reaching a maximum at a carbon number of 9 or 10, and then decreases. Thus, asphaltenes often can begin precipitating with a smaller volume of n-hexadecane than with n-pentane, even though large volumes ...
